Who we are

Claire Martin

Artistic Direction & Production

Claire Martin OBE has established herself as a tour de force on the UK jazz scene since turning professional at the age of 19. Since then she has released 23 albums as band leader for the Scottish based label Linn Records and Denmark based Stunt Records, winning multiple awards along the way, including Best Vocalist in the UK Jazz Awards seven times, a BASCA Gold Badge for Services to Music and in 2011 receiving an OBE for her Services to Jazz. Claire is a featured soloist in various European orchestras and big bands.

In 2020 Claire started ‘Soup to Nuts’ Productions with Chris Traves and has since gone on to produce a number of acclaimed jazz vocal albums.

Elaine Crouch

Strategy, Operations & Label Management

Elaine Crouch is a highly experienced project and label manager with a proven track record of ensuring successful delivery of creative projects through bespoke, practical strategies for securing funding, budget/risk and change management, and project evaluation. 

She has a wealth of relevant experience in the music industry gained from 8 years as label manager with Whirlwind Recordings and through her work as a freelance tour developer.

Elaine lectures in ‘Music Business’ at BIMM (Brighton), ‘Professional Development’ at Guildhall School of Music & Drama, and ‘Funding Creative Projects’ at the Royal Academy of Music.

Emma Perry

Marketing & PR

With over 25 years in the music industry, Emma Perry has experience working in concert and festival production (Serious), international marketing (Universal International Classics & Jazz),  European promotion (Rykodisc/Hannibal) agency booking (Michael Nyman, Ivor Cutler) and project management (White Foundation International Saxophone Competition).  In 2008 she launched the international concert series Made in the UK with ESIP’s John Ellson, as well as the independent label Global Mix, which released critically acclaimed albums such as Guy Barker’s The Amadeus Project, winner of the 2008 Parliamentary Jazz Award for best album.  More recently she has been working in UK marketing and PR with artists such as Trish Clowes, the bassist Avishai Cohen, Jean Toussaint and Cleveland Watkiss as well as independent labels Banger Factory Records, Ubuntu Music and Whirlwind Recordings. 

A fluent French speaker, Emma studied French and Music at Goldsmith’s College, University of London and has an MA in Arts Management from City University, London.

Nadja von Massow

Creative & Business Development

Nadja von Massow is a creative strategist, designer and artist consultant. After a two-decade career of heading digital and creative teams at leading Marketing agencies and incorporating nadworks ltd. in 2012 along the way, her focus has turned exclusively to working with musicians and music organisations since 2019. As artist manager and creative director Nadja’s clients on both sides of the pond include vibes player Joe Locke, Grammy winner Geoffrey Keezer, Claire Martin OBE, LSO Live, Raul Midón, the Scottish National Jazz Orchestra, members of the Juilliard String Quartet, Ian Shaw, Black Lives in Music, Tim Garland, Terreon Gully, Mike Lindup, Geneva Music Festival, Classical:NEXT, ATX Chamber Music and Jazz, the National Youth Jazz Collective and many more, including various North American and European record labels. 

Nadja is also a passionate educator and is currently teaching web development at the Royal Conservatoire of Scotland in Glasgow.
